Ducati Diavel V4 Variants, Colours & On-Road Price Breakdown 2026
Ducati keeps it simple with the Diavel V4 - two variants in India, differentiated by colour. Both share the same 1158cc V4 Granturismo engine, full electronics suite, and Brembo braking hardware. The Rs 31,000 price gap is entirely down to finish and paint.
Diavel V4 Ducati Red - Rs 29,07,600 (ex-showroom) The Ducati Red is the base variant and the purist's pick. This is the colour the Diavel was built to wear - the classic Ducati rosso with contrasting black powertrain and frame elements. On-road prices vary significantly by state: around Rs 32.58 lakh in Delhi and up to Rs 36.08 lakh in Bangalore, where state road tax rates are among the highest in the country.
Diavel V4 Thrilling Black - Rs 29,38,600 (ex-showroom) The Thrilling Black variant applies a blacked-out treatment to the Diavel's already muscular silhouette, making it look more aggressive and slightly more discreet for riders who prefer not to announce themselves. On-road in Delhi, this variant comes to approximately Rs 32.89 lakh.
For comparison, the Triumph Rocket 3 starts at around Rs 22.49 lakh - roughly Rs 6.5 lakh less than the Diavel V4 base price. Factor in that Ducati servicing costs are higher than most rivals, and authorised service centres are concentrated in metros.

Ducati India offers vehicle financing through its dealership network. EMI on the Diavel V4 starts at approximately Rs 87,000 per month on a standard 36-month term at 10% interest (subject to lender and credit profile). Comprehensive insurance for the first year is typically Rs 70,000-80,000. A note on registration: Karnataka's luxury vehicle road tax significantly inflates on-road prices - Bangalore buyers pay approximately Rs 3.5 lakh more in taxes than Delhi buyers for the same motorcycle. If you are near a state border with lower tax rates, verify with the RTO and dealership whether cross-state registration is legally permissible in your situation.
